Heronian elliptic curves and the size of the 2-Selmer group
Abstract
A generalization of the congruent number problem is to find positive integers n that appear as the areas of Heron triangles. Selmer group of a congruent number elliptic curve has been studied quite extensively. Here, we look into the 2-Selmer group structure for Heronian elliptic curves associated with Heron triangles of area n and one of the angle θ such that θ2 = n-1 and n2+1=2q for some prime q.
